Understanding Titanium Dioxide
Titanium dioxide, a white pigment, is renowned for its brightness and high refractive index. It is commonly utilized in paints, coatings, plastics, paper, and cosmetics. The compound exists in several forms, but the two primary crystalline forms are anatase and rutile. Recently, there has been a surge in the interest surrounding precipitated titanium dioxide, which is synthesized through chemical processes to produce fine, uniform particles with desirable characteristics.
Production of Precipitated Titanium Dioxide
The production of precipitated titanium dioxide typically involves several stages, including sulfate and chloride processes. The sulfate process, more traditional and popular in China, begins with the treatment of titanium ore with sulfuric acid. This method generates titanyl sulfate, which is then hydrolyzed to yield titanium dioxide precipitate.
In contrast, the chloride process involves the reaction of titanium tetrachloride (TiCl4) with oxygen at elevated temperatures. Although this method is more efficient and produces higher quality titanium dioxide, it is relatively more expensive and less prevalent in China than the sulfate process.
After synthesis, the precipitated material undergoes various treatments, including washing, drying, and milling, to achieve the desired particle size and purity. These processes are critical to ensure that the final product meets the stringent specifications required for various applications.
Applications of Precipitated Titanium Dioxide
Precipitated titanium dioxide is primarily valued for its unique properties that make it suitable for numerous applications
1. Coatings and Paints Due to its excellent opacity, brightness, and durability, precipitated TiO2 is a preferred choice in the production of paint and coatings. It enhances color retention and weather resistance, making it ideal for both indoor and outdoor applications.
2. Plastics and Polymers The addition of titanium dioxide in plastics aids in UV protection, thermal stability, and improves mechanical strength. It is widely used in the production of packaging materials, automotive components, and household goods, enabling longer product life and improved performance.
3. Cosmetics In the cosmetics industry, titanium dioxide is employed for its pigment properties and as a sunscreen agent. Its ability to scatter UV radiation helps protect the skin from harmful effects, making it a popular ingredient in various skincare products.
4. Food and Pharmaceuticals Precipitated titanium dioxide is also used as a food additive and in pharmaceuticals. It serves as a whitening agent in food products and plays a role in the formulation of tablets and capsules, ensuring uniformity and stability.
